WebJan 24, 2024 · Bok choy is a veggie that is packed full of flavor. The first difference between napa cabbage and bok choy is their appearance. Bok choy is slightly larger than napa cabbage at 12 to 24 inches long. It has thick white stalks and dark green leaves, which are distinctly spoon-shaped.
